The Sr. Director, Pre-Si System Validation leads AMD's system-level modeling — including emulation — and pre-silicon validation for Data Center GPU platforms. This role ensures early, system-accurate insights across AI, HPC, and cloud-scale environments, accelerating software readiness, reducing integration risk, and enabling end-to-end HW/SW co-design. It drives holistic evaluation of GPU SoCs, platforms, and rack-scale systems ahead of silicon availability.
Operating at the center of DCGPU execution, the individual partners with architecture, silicon, systems, software, performance, and customer teams, while engaging senior leadership and key customers.
The role owns the end-to-end pre-silicon validation strategy, infrastructure, methodology, and execution across AMD's Instinct\u2122 GPUs, ROCm\u2122 platform, and broader compute ecosystem, with direct interface to executive, CTO, and BU leadership.
